一、centos 安装 apache 2.4
CentOS 安装 Apache 2.4
在CentOS服务器上安装Apache 2.4是搭建网站和应用程序的关键步骤之一。Apache是世界上最流行的Web服务器之一,而CentOS是一种广泛使用的Linux操作系统,将它们结合在一起能够为您的项目提供可靠的基础架构。在本文中,我将向您介绍在CentOS上安装Apache 2.4的步骤和注意事项。
步骤 1:更新系统
在开始安装Apache之前,首先需要确保您的CentOS系统是最新的。运行以下命令来更新所有软件包:
sudo yum update
步骤 2:安装Apache 2.4
一旦系统更新完成,您可以使用以下命令来在CentOS上安装Apache 2.4:
sudo yum install httpd
步骤 3:启动 Apache 服务
安装完成后,使用以下命令启动Apache服务:
sudo systemctl start httpd
步骤 4:设置开机自启
为了确保Apache在系统启动时自动运行,执行以下命令:
sudo systemctl enable httpd
步骤 5:配置防火墙
如果您的CentOS服务器正在运行防火墙,确保打开HTTP和HTTPS通信端口:
sudo firewall-cmd --permanent --add-service=http
sudo firewall-cmd --permanent --add-service=https
sudo firewall-cmd --reload
步骤 6:验证安装
最后,使用您的浏览器访问服务器的公共IP地址或域名来验证Apache是否已成功安装。如果一切设置正确,您将看到Apache的欢迎页面。
总结
通过本文的指导,您已经成功在CentOS服务器上安装了Apache 2.4,并进行了基本的配置。现在,您可以开始在这个强大的Web服务器上部署您的网站和应用程序。请确保定期更新和维护Apache,以确保您的服务器始终保持安全和高效。
二、centos yum apache2.4
近年来,**CentOS**操作系统由于其稳定性和安全性备受企业用户青睐。作为一种基于Linux的发行版,CentOS不仅提供了广泛的软件支持,还具有强大的软件包管理工具——**YUM**(Yellowdog Updater, Modified)。在本文中,我们将重点探讨如何通过YUM在CentOS系统上安装和管理**Apache 2.4**服务器。
1. 更新YUM软件包索引
在开始安装Apache 2.4之前,首先需要确保YUM软件包索引是最新的。通过运行以下命令,您可以更新YUM的软件包索引:
yum update2. 安装Apache 2.4
安装Apache 2.4服务器是在CentOS系统上托管网站和应用程序的常见需求。要安装Apache 2.4,请执行以下操作:
yum install httpd
3. 启动Apache 2.4
安装完成后,可以使用以下命令启动Apache 2.4服务器:
systemctl start httpd
4. 设置开机自启
为了确保Apache 2.4在系统启动时自动启动,您可以运行以下命令设置开机自启动:
systemctl enable httpd
5. 配置防火墙
要允许HTTP流量通过防火墙到达Apache 2.4服务器,您需要配置防火墙规则。运行以下命令以允许HTTP流量:
firewall-cmd --zone=public --permanent --add-service=http firewall-cmd --reload
6. 配置虚拟主机
如果您计划在Apache 2.4服务器上托管多个网站或应用程序,最好配置虚拟主机。可以通过以下步骤设置虚拟主机:
- 在/etc/httpd/conf/httpd.conf文件中添加虚拟主机配置
- 创建一个新的虚拟主机配置文件,如/etc/httpd/conf.d/example.conf
- 在新的配置文件中定义您的虚拟主机设置
7. 重启Apache服务器
完成虚拟主机配置后,务必重启Apache服务器以应用更改:
systemctl restart httpd
8. 安装额外模块
Apache 2.4支持各种模块,以扩展其功能。您可以使用YUM安装额外的Apache模块,例如PHP支持模块:
yum install php
通过以上步骤,您可以在CentOS系统上成功安装和管理Apache 2.4服务器。记得定期更新系统和软件包以确保服务器的安全和稳定运行。
三、apache2.4 域名配置
Apache 2.4 域名配置指南
Apache 是一款非常受欢迎的开源 Web 服务器软件,用于配置和管理网站的访问。在本篇文章中,我们将详细介绍如何使用 Apache 2.4 来进行域名配置。
为什么域名配置如此重要?
域名配置对于一个网站的访问非常关键。通过正确配置域名,可以将用户请求正确地路由到相应的网站目录,实现正确的访问页面。同时,合理的域名配置也有助于搜索引擎优化,提升网站的排名。
Apache 2.4 域名配置步骤
下面是在 Apache 2.4 中进行域名配置的详细步骤:
- 确认 Apache 2.4 已正确安装并运行。
- 打开 Apache 2.4 的配置文件(httpd.conf)。
- 找到并编辑以下配置项:VirtualHost 和 ServerName。
- 在 VirtualHost 中指定网站的根目录。
- 在 ServerName 中指定网站的域名。
- 保存并关闭配置文件。
- 重启 Apache 2.4 服务。
通过以上步骤,我们就可以成功配置一个域名到 Apache 2.4,并让网站通过该域名访问。
常见问题及解决方案
在进行域名配置的过程中,可能会遇到一些常见问题。下面是一些常见问题的解决方案:
问题一:域名无法解析
解决方案:请确认域名已正确解析到服务器,可以通过命令行工具如 nslookup 或 ping 来进行域名解析测试。
问题二:配置修改后无效
解决方案:请确认在修改配置文件后已重新加载 Apache 2.4 服务,可以通过执行命令 "apachectl -k restart" 来重新启动服务。
问题三:错误的网站目录
解决方案:请确认在配置文件中正确指定了网站的根目录,可以使用绝对路径或相关环境变量。
总结
通过本篇文章的学习,我们了解了 Apache 2.4 的域名配置方法。正确配置域名对于网站的访问和搜索引擎优化非常重要。希望本篇文章对你在配置 Apache 2.4 域名时有所帮助。
祝你配置成功!
四、centos安装apache2.4
bash sudo yum update五、新手请教个Apache2.2与Apache2.4中文支持区别的问题?
这个问题已经解决,修改/etc/apache2/mods-available/这个路径下的ssl.conf文件,在“SSLSessionCache shmcb:${APACHE_RUN_DIR}/ssl_scache(512000)”这条语句之前,添加语句“LoadModule socache_shmcb_module /usr/lib/apache2/modules/mod_socache_shmcb.so” ,开启socache_shmcb_module,并且不同版本的apache对应的mod_socache_shmcb.so存放路径还会有所差异,对我而言,存放路径是/usr/lib/apache2/modules/mod_socache_shmcb.so
六、php5.4 mysqli
PHP5.4的mysqli扩展介绍
PHP是一种被广泛应用于Web开发领域的编程语言,而在PHP中,mysqli(MySQL Improved)扩展为开发人员提供了与MySQL数据库进行交互的强大功能。特别是在PHP5.4版本中,mysqli扩展得到了进一步的优化与改进,使其在开发Web应用程序过程中变得更加高效与可靠。
mysqli扩展为PHP提供了一组API函数,允许开发人员执行各种与MySQL数据库相关的操作,包括连接、查询、更新等。相比传统的mysql扩展,mysqli具有诸多优势,如支持MySQL的新特性、提供面向对象接口等。在PHP5.4版本中,mysqli得到了改进,增加了更多的功能和性能优化,使其成为开发人员首选的数据库扩展之一。
PHP5.4中mysqli扩展的主要特点
- 面向对象接口: PHP5.4中的mysqli扩展提供了面向对象的接口,使代码更加模块化和易于维护。开发人员可以通过面向对象的方式来操作数据库,提高了代码的可读性和可维护性。
- 支持事务: mysqli扩展在PHP5.4中增加了对事务的支持,开发人员可以通过事务来确保数据库操作的一致性,避免数据异常或错误。
- 预处理语句: mysqli扩展提供了预处理语句的支持,可以有效防止SQL注入攻击,提高了应用程序的安全性。
- 性能优化: PHP5.4版本中对mysqli扩展的性能进行了优化,提高了数据库操作的效率和响应速度,对于处理大量数据库操作的应用程序尤为重要。
- 支持存储过程: mysqli扩展在PHP5.4中增加了对存储过程的支持,开发人员可以更好地利用数据库的存储过程功能,实现更复杂的业务逻辑。
PHP5.4中mysqli扩展的使用示例
下面是一个简单的示例,演示了如何在PHP5.4中使用mysqli扩展连接到MySQL数据库并执行查询操作:
<?php
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"myDB";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// 检查连接是否成功
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
// 执行查询操作
$sql = "SELECT id, name, email FROM users";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
// 输出数据
while($row = $result->fetch_assoc()) {
echo "id: " . $row["id"]. " - Name: " . $row["name"]. " - Email: " . $row["email"]. "<br>";
}
} else {
echo "0 结果";
}
$conn->close();
?>
通过上述示例,我们可以看到,在PHP5.4中使用mysqli扩展连接到数据库并执行查询操作非常简单直观。开发人员可以通过mysqli提供的丰富功能和性能优化,轻松实现与MySQL数据库的交互,开发出高效稳定的Web应用程序。
结语
总的来说,PHP5.4中的mysqli扩展为开发人员提供了强大的数据库操作功能,并在性能和安全性方面进行了优化,使得开发人员能够更加高效地开发Web应用程序。通过充分利用mysqli扩展的各种特性和优势,开发人员可以编写出更加稳健和安全的代码,为用户提供更好的使用体验。
七、wdcp php5.4
技术博客:优化您的网站性能与安全性
在当今数字化时代,拥有一个快速且安全的网站对于任何在线业务都至关重要。随着技术的不断发展,网站管理员们需要不断更新和优化他们的网站,以确保其性能和安全性得以维持。本文将重点讨论如何通过升级您的网站托管环境来提高网站性能和安全性,我们将重点关注 wdcp 和 php5.4。
什么是WDCP?
WDCP(Web Data Control Panel)是一个基于Linux系统的Web服务器管理面板,它提供了一个简单易用的界面来管理您的服务器配置、域名、数据库等。通过使用 WDCP,您可以快速搭建和管理您的网站,节省时间和精力。
为什么升级到PHP 5.4?
PHP是一种流行的服务器端脚本语言,许多网站和Web应用程序都是使用PHP来构建的。升级到PHP 5.4版本可以为您的网站带来许多好处,包括更高的性能、更好的安全性和更好的兼容性。
- 性能改进:PHP 5.4引入了许多新的特性和优化,使得您的网站可以更快地响应用户请求。
- 安全性增强:PHP 5.4修复了许多安全漏洞,并提供了更多的安全选项,以保护您的网站免受恶意攻击。
- 兼容性:许多现有的PHP应用程序已经升级到PHP 5.4,并且它与大多数主流Web服务器兼容,这意味着您可以顺利升级而不会破坏现有的应用程序。
如何升级您的网站到PHP 5.4?
升级您的网站到PHP 5.4是一项重要的工作,以下是一些步骤和建议:
- 备份您的网站文件和数据库:在进行任何升级之前,务必备份您的网站文件和数据库以防止数据丢失。
- 检查您的应用程序是否兼容PHP 5.4:在升级之前,确保您的应用程序支持PHP 5.4,并且没有与之不兼容的插件或扩展。
- 升级到最新版本的WDCP:确保您的WDCP面板是最新版本,以确保其与PHP 5.4兼容。
- 在测试环境中进行升级:在生产环境之前,在测试环境中进行升级以确保一切正常。
- 逐步升级:在生产环境中逐步升级您的网站到PHP 5.4,监控性能和安全性。
最佳实践和注意事项
在升级您的网站到PHP 5.4时,以下是一些最佳实践和注意事项:
- 定期备份您的网站文件和数据库,以防止意外数据丢失。
- 监控您的网站性能和安全性,定期进行漏洞扫描和性能测试。
- 遵循最佳安全实践,包括定期更新您的应用程序和插件,使用安全的密码和SSL证书。
- 优化您的数据库和代码,以提高网站的性能和响应速度。
总的来说,通过升级您的网站托管环境到WDCP和PHP 5.4,您可以提高网站的性能和安全性,为用户提供更好的体验,并确保您的在线业务顺利运行。
八、pnlite php5.4
如何升级您的网站至 PHP 版本 5.4
在当今互联网时代,网站是企业展示自己形象、吸引客户的重要工具,而 PHP 作为网站开发的重要技术之一,其版本升级也显得尤为重要。本文将重点讨论如何将网站升级至 PHP 5.4 版本,以满足现代化开发需求。
首先,让我们来看一下 PHP 5.4 版本的重要性。PHP 5.4 是 PHP 5.x 版本中的一个重要更新,它引入了很多新的特性和改进,包括更好的性能、更高的安全性以及更好的语言特性支持。因此,升级至 PHP 5.4 不仅可以提升网站的性能,也可以增强网站的安全性,给用户更好的体验。
升级准备工作
在开始升级之前,我们需要做好一些准备工作。首先,要确保您的网站和应用程序兼容 PHP 5.4 版本。如果您的网站使用了一些过时的 PHP 函数或语法,可能会在 PHP 5.4 下出现问题。因此,建议您在升级之前进行一次全面的代码审查,确保所有代码都符合 PHP 5.4 的语法规范。
其次,备份您的网站数据是非常重要的。在升级过程中,可能会出现意外情况导致数据丢失,因此在进行升级之前务必备份好所有数据。这样即使出现问题,也可以随时恢复到之前的状态。
升级步骤
接下来我们来详细讨论升级步骤。首先,您需要下载最新的 PHP 5.4 版本,并安装在您的服务器上。这一步通常比较简单,您可以从 PHP 官方网站下载最新版本的 PHP,并按照安装说明进行安装。
一旦 PHP 5.4 安装完成,接下来就需要修改您的网站配置文件以指定 PHP 版本。您需要找到您的网站配置文件(通常是 php.ini 文件)并将其中的 PHP 版本指定为 5.4。这样在运行网站时就会使用 PHP 5.4 版本。
最后,您需要测试您的网站是否正常运行。在升级完成后,建议您对网站进行全面测试,确保所有功能都正常运行。特别要注意一些与 PHP 5.4 不兼容的地方,比如过时的函数调用、语法错误等。
优化性能
除了升级至 PHP 5.4 版本,您还可以进一步优化网站性能。PHP 5.4 版本引入了一些新的特性和优化,可以帮助提升网站的性能。比如,您可以考虑使用 pnlite 扩展来加速 PHP 的执行速度,从而提升整体性能。
此外,您还可以优化数据库查询、使用缓存技术等来提升网站性能。使用一些 PHP 性能分析工具可以帮助您找到网站性能瓶颈,并进行相应优化。
结语
PHP 5.4 版本作为一个重要的 PHP 更新,为网站开发者提供了更好的性能、安全性和功能支持。通过将网站升级至 PHP 5.4 版本,并进行进一步优化,您可以让网站更加现代化,提升用户体验。希望本文对您升级网站至 PHP 5.4 版本有所帮助。
九、apache全名?
Apache(音译为阿帕奇)是世界使用排名第一的Web服务器软件。它可以运行在几乎所有广泛使用的计算机平台上,由于其跨平台和安全性被广泛使用,是最流行的Web服务器端软件之一。
它快速、可靠并且可通过简单的API扩充,将Perl/Python等解释器编译到服务器中。
十、centos yum php5.4
CentOS中使用Yum安装PHP5.4的方法
在CentOS操作系统上安装PHP5.4可以通过Yum软件包管理器轻松完成。PHP5.4版本虽然已经比较老旧,但仍然有一些特定应用程序需要使用此版本。下面将介绍如何在CentOS上使用Yum来安装PHP5.4。
步骤一:更新Yum软件包
首先确保您的CentOS系统已经更新了Yum软件包管理器,以便获取最新的软件包信息。在终端中输入以下命令:
sudo yum update
确认软件包更新完成后,继续执行下一步骤。
步骤二:添加EPEL存储库
安装PHP5.4需要使用EPEL存储库,因此需要先安装并启用EPEL存储库。执行以下命令:
sudo yum install epel-release
安装完成后,您可以继续安装PHP5.4。
步骤三:安装PHP5.4
现在可以使用Yum来安装PHP5.4。输入以下命令:
sudo yum install php54
Yum将开始下载并安装PHP5.4及其相关依赖项。安装完成后,您可以验证PHP版本:
php -v
在终端中输入以上命令,即可查看安装的PHP版本信息。
步骤四:安装PHP扩展
安装PHP5.4后,您可能需要安装一些PHP扩展来满足您的需求。您可以使用Yum来安装PHP5.4的各种扩展。以下是一些常用的PHP扩展及其安装方式:
- 安装PHP MySQL扩展:
sudo yum install php54-mysql
sudo yum install php54-gd
sudo yum install php54-curl
根据您的需求安装相应的PHP扩展,以达到满足项目需求的目的。
步骤五:配置PHP
安装PHP5.4后,您可能需要对PHP进行一些配置。您可以编辑PHP的配置文件php.ini来修改各种设置。php.ini文件通常位于/etc/php.ini
或者/etc/php/5.4/php.ini
。您可以使用文本编辑器来编辑这些文件,并根据需要修改设置。
一些常用的配置包括修改内存限制、上传文件大小限制、时区设置等。确保您保存了更改,并重新加载PHP以使更改生效。
总结
通过上述步骤,您可以在CentOS上使用Yum轻松安装PHP5.4,并根据需要安装相应的PHP扩展。记得始终确保您的系统安全,并保持软件包更新以获得最新的功能和安全性修复。
希望这篇指南对您有所帮助!
- 相关评论
- 我要评论
-